Local Weather Risks in Merritt

πŸŒͺ️

Triggers

Sustained winds above 40 mph, tropical storm systems, nor'easters, ice storms, and freeze-thaw cycles all put stress on garage door hardware. Power surges during storms can also fry opener circuit boards.

πŸ“…

Seasonal Risks

In coastal North Carolina, emergency garage door calls spike during hurricane season (June–November) and winter storm events. High winds can tear doors off tracks or damage openers. Heavy rain and flooding can warp panels, rust springs, and short-circuit automatic openers.

🏚️

Disaster Scenarios

After hurricanes or severe thunderstorms: doors may be blown off tracks, panels may be punctured by debris, and openers may fail due to water or electrical surge damage. In freezing conditions, weather seals can freeze doors shut, and cold metal springs become brittle and prone to snapping.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• βœ“ Test your garage door balance every few months by disconnecting the opener and manually lifting the door halfway. It should stay in place. If it falls, springs need adjustment.
  • βœ“ Inspect cables and springs monthly for rust, fraying, or gaps. A snapped spring can cause major damage and injury.
  • βœ“ Check the auto-reverse feature: place a small object like a block of wood under the door. If it does not reverse on contact, the safety sensors need immediate attention.
  • βœ“ Before hurricane season, confirm your door is rated for wind load. Many coastal areas in NC have building codes that require wind-rated doors. Replace older doors that may not meet current standards.
  • βœ“ Keep tracks clean and free of debris. Coastal humidity and salt air accelerate rust in Pamlico County. Lubricate moving parts with a silicone-based spray twice a year.
  • βœ“ Never leave your garage door partially open. This puts uneven stress on springs and tracks and can cause the door to fall.

❓ Can I manually open my garage door in an emergency?

Only if it is safe to do so. Pull the emergency release cord to disconnect the opener, then lift manually. If the door is off its tracks, sagging, or has broken springs or cables, do not attempt to open it manually. The door can fall with tremendous force and cause serious injury.

❓ Will my home insurance cover emergency garage door repair?

Many homeowners insurance policies cover garage door damage caused by storms, vehicle impact, or vandalism. Damage from wear and tear or lack of maintenance is typically not covered. Check with your provider. Some local repair professionals can help document damage for claims purposes.

❓ Can a snapped spring be fixed without replacing it?

No. Snapped springs must always be replaced. Attempting to reuse or repair a broken spring is extremely dangerous. Garage door springs are under very high tension and can cause severe injury or death if handled incorrectly. Always leave spring replacement to a trained professional.

❓ Should I unplug my garage door opener during an emergency?

Yes, if it is safe to access the outlet. Unplugging the opener prevents accidental activation while the door is being inspected or repaired. It also protects the unit from power surges during electrical storms. If the opener is smoking or sparking, unplug it immediately and call for help.
